Cerro Parva del Inca
Cerro Parva del Inca is a peak in San Esteban, Los Andes Province, Valparaíso Region and has an elevation of 4,820 metres.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Portillo
Photo: Sinopsis,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Portillo is a ski resort in Central Chile. It is close to the Argentine border, and the skiing area runs right across the serpentine road to Mendoza.
